And now I will introduce my new favorite food to you, the very exotic dragon tongue bean!

It's an heirloom type of snap pea, and it changes colors when you cook it. Pretty similar to a green bean, except there are no strings, and they taste a WHOLE lot better.

We got them at the Taylor Farmer's Market this Saturday because we thought they looked crazy, and I am so glad we did! I need a lifetime supply of these things. We grilled them with olive oil, salt, pepper, and garlic and added fresh basil after they were done. The grill-y taste was amazing. If you can find some of these, buy them!!!!
